plant-care Super new to this...

So this is my first time growing peppers and I know I am already a bit behind on timing and it is super hot all of a sudden here in Colorado (102 today!) I took a couple pictures of my peppers and mostly curious about the closeup of one of them. I am assuming the dark places around the "bud stems" and the brown color of what would be the flowers is due to it being too hot? Would that be accurate?

It's a normal pigmentation that shows up at those locations in some varieties (anthocyanin). The intense sun might make it show up even darker than usual.
